Transaction dab1ec14e65bd362afb5eff0c96d452c20407ea0ff6da2bd24dc6a9d5c4a2113
1 Input
1 Output
-
dab1ec14e65bd362afb5eff0c96d452c20407ea0ff6da2bd24dc6a9d5c4a2113:0
- value
- 42679563
- script pubkey
- OP_0 OP_PUSHBYTES_20 3da5d2520638039f07146ecba3dc95b1f5ba606f
- address
- bc1q8kjay5sx8qpe7pc5dm968hy4k86m5cr03mdjkj